47th Annual Sierra Nevada Arts & Crafts Festival

Bookmark and Share
Location Arnold
Dates July 06, 2019 - July 07, 2019
Description:

From 47th Annual Sierra Nevada Arts & Crafts Festival Website:

The Sierra Nevada Arts & Crafts Festival starts with a classic, small-town parade with vintage cars, local businesses, emergency services, schools and civic organizations represented. It starts on the Saturday of July 4th weekend at 10:00 am at the east end of town on Highway 4 and ends at Cedar Center, with a beautiful, live rendition of American the Beautiful. The parade route which is the Arnold stretch of Highway 4 is closed by 9:00 am.

The whole community gets involved, and Highway 4 is lined with locals and visitors alike, enjoying this timeless, traditional parade in keeping with the best of American small town celebrations.

The festivities continue with the Sierra Nevada Arts & Crafts Festival in the grounds at Bristols Ranch House Cafe at 961 Highway 4, Arnold CA a tradition that has been an important part of Arnolds 4th July celebrations for over 45 years. This part of the event features fine crafts, fine art, gourmet foods, and continuous live entertainment.

Situated among the pines and redwoods at the 4000-ft elevation, the festival features over 50 booths of original crafts & art in all media.

The Arnold Lions Club serves an all-you-can-eat pancake breakfast from 7:30 am 11:00 am both days for just $8.

During the festival, the Ebbetts Pass Volunteer Fire Department serves local Calaveras County beers, and a variety of home-made food booths round out the deliciousness. After the festival, they hold their annual BBQ with live music on Saturday evening making for a full day of fun!
